Output 6623c94d553758d590133767e208a50b1c5570c5e78f77d9aac6a3eec34b6500:9

value
270389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fd9335f30aabafaa543a9121ed5b6d737985996 OP_EQUALVERIFY OP_CHECKSIG
address
13uQ9KD8PsBptkJsMq3dBaF5GWSBEdsabS
transaction
6623c94d553758d590133767e208a50b1c5570c5e78f77d9aac6a3eec34b6500
spent
true